Statistics will be coming gradually as well as info about results in each round. Now general ( and official) standings.
Points were granted: one for claiming each victory point on the field ( 5 per battle, max) plus one for winning each battle. Small points are difference between losses of each participating force per battle – summarized. There were 5 Rounds in two days aprox. 2,5 hour per battle or 6 rounds, 1200 points armies, UWZ rules (official Polish UWZ rules! guys have made it before Con! :D) with actual English and Polish FaQ.

I like the one with 9 Mounted Hussars charging over the bridge towards the Brotherhood. Did they succeed?
Thanks :) The charge was success, though I paid my price in blood:
- first unit of MH charged and waiting Sacred Warriors...
- ...and then was massacred by rest of SW team
- in order to attack, SW had to move forward - that put them in range (we played at artic lvl 6 - LOS was 18'') of Viktors' cannons (you may guess what came next :) )
- later second unit of MH (supported by Johan Emingholtz) moved over remians of SW and started to spread mayhem on the other side of the bridge

Small explanation: taking control over bridge was crucial bacuse we played for victory points located there (not no. kills)
